[4:06]when we reach this point about the creation of Adam and this
[4:13]is the topic for tonight we get into this issue of evolution
[4:18]that when we look at the verses of the Holy Quran when
[4:23]we look at the it seems as if the creation of Adam
[4:30]it was instant aneous in nature meaning that Allah subhanahu wa taala
[4:34]he said be and the creation of Adam was but in the
[4:40]modern day era we're faced with a theory known as Evolution which
[4:44]teaches that everything that exists on the face of this Earth it
[4:49]has a common point of origin everything that exists from the trees
[4:54]from the fish from the human being if you go back in
[4:59]time it came through this grad ual process of evolution where one
[5:02]being gives rise to another being and that being gives rise to
[5:07]another being until eventually we as human beings have been created is
[5:12]there an Islamic theory that combines the evidence that we have for
[5:17]evolution with the verses of the Quran as Believers are we supposed
[5:23]to reject the theory of evolution does it go against the verses
[5:27]of the Quran and theith inshallah tonight I wanted to dive deep
[5:32]into this discussion and open up a few of these issues now

[7:36]with our belief in God now when we go back to the
[7:40]history of the theory of evolution you look at the 1850s in
[7:43]the Western World an individual by the name of Charles Darwin he
[7:46]comes about and he argues that based upon the fossil record that
[7:53]they had began to find he argues that when we look at
[7:56]these fossil records we see that there are Creations which become more
[8:00]and more complex as time goes on and so he comes out
[8:05]with this theory of evolution that from the very beginning all of
[8:09]the things which exist in this world they all have a common
[8:15]point of origin now for the Christian world this was a very
[8:19]difficult Theory to Grapple with because for a group of people that
[8:22]believe in the Bible they believed that God created Adam the human
[8:31]race the directly and so this idea that we came about and
[8:34]part of our ancestry it goes to monkeys and primates it was
[8:39]a very difficult pill for the Christian world to swallow you know
[8:43]just imagine you're sitting at the zoo and you're looking at monkeys
[8:48]and you're wondering is that my forefather is that Grandpa you know
[8:51]sitting there and he's making noises and he's jumping around it's difficult
[8:58]for us as human beings to accept this now eventually it was
[9:00]accepted within the Christian world because the authority of the church one
[9:04]had been weakened but number two they kept finding pieces of evidence
[9:08]after pieces of evidence now eventually this Theory it begins to move
[9:14]into the Muslim world and during that time it wasn't like today
[9:17]where when something comes about it's instantaneously transmitted into the internet and
[9:24]it reaches the entirety of the world it gradually begins to seep
[9:28]into the Muslim world and Muslims just like their Christian counterparts they
[9:32]begin to Grapple with this question that it seems as if this
[9:39]theory of evolution it has a lot of weight behind it and
[9:42]so as Muslims who believe in the Quran we believe in the
[9:45]of how do we deal with this issue now traditionally Muslims when
[9:50]they had read the verses of the Quran 200 years ago 300
[9:53]years ago it seemed as if the verses of the Quran were
[9:58]very clear and I wanted to mention a few of these verses
[10:00]because it speaks about the creation of our forefather Adam the first
[10:06]verse it [Music] mentions Allah subhana wa tala he says to the
[10:18]angels indeed I am going to create human beings from mud now
[10:22]you look at this verse there's no mention of evolution there's no
[10:27]mention of monkeys primates there's no no mention of any primordial soup
[10:32]there's no mention of any of these things it seems as if
[10:37]Allah is directly creating Adam and then we look even further in
[10:41]the Quran there's many verses on this topic the second [Music] verse
[10:56]here this becomes even more powerful Allah subhana wa tala in mentioning
[11:02]the example of Jesus he says the following he says the example
[11:09]of Jesus in the eyes of Allah is indeed like the example
[11:17]of Adam he created him from dust and then he said to
[11:20]him be and he was so Muslims they are reading these types
[11:26]of verses and it seems very clear that Allah subhana wa tala
[11:29]he's not mentioned mening Evolution he's not mentioning any process in fact
[11:33]he is mentioning an instantaneous process of creation is an instantaneous process

[13:52]going to insh go along with this let us imagine for a
[13:57]moment that evolution is the correct Theory and by the way it
[14:01]is simply a theory it is not a fact it is not
[14:05]proven beyond a shadow of a doubt it is a theory Al
[14:08]bit we say it is a strong Theory let's go along with
[14:14]this and let us believe that this is the best understanding of
[14:20]these verses as we begin to go into this we look at
[14:23]the fossil record and when you look in the fossil record what
[14:28]we find is that there are groups of creation that preceded our
[14:32]own creation as Homo sapiens and I was looking online I was
[14:35]trying to find these different beings that had been created that they
[14:42]say is the link between us and the initial Creations the first
[14:46]creation there is something by the name of Homo habilis that appears
[14:53]2.4 million years ago and it goes extinct about 1.4 million years
[14:58]ago it's a long time when we really think about how long
[15:04]ago this was it boggles the mind so this was one of
[15:06]the first they say humanik Creations that we find but when you
[15:13]look at this skeleton it doesn't really look like a human being
[15:17]in fact it is closer to a primate than a human being
[15:21]after that we see other ones there's one called homo rudal fenus
[15:24]and I think maybe a British individual named these they all have
[15:28]strange names homo rudal fenis it appears 1.9 million years ago and
[15:35]it goes extinct 1.8 million years ago and then it continues there
[15:38]is being after being after being until we eventually reach the Neanderthals
[15:45]that came into existence 200,000 years ago and they go extinct 40,000
[15:51]years ago and eventually we reach the creation of homo sapiens Homo
[15:58]sapiens they come about 210,000 years ago and they continue until today
[16:04]so here we are assuming that this idea of evolution is correct
[16:09]we're going to take the verses of the Quran metaphorically and we're
[16:13]going to say that when Allah subh he creates him and he
[16:17]breathes into him that rof is the first of the homo sapiens
[16:25]so 200,000 years ago we are saying that if we believe in
[16:31]the theory of evolution everything is okay Adam was created about 200,000
[16:35]years ago when this Homo Sapien comes about he has a larger
[16:38]brain he's anatomically similar to me and you this is Adam now
[16:45]as soon as we buy into this we begin to run into
[16:50]a few different issues issue number one when we look at the
[16:54]story of and the two sons of Adam now the story is
[17:02]in the Quran it's in theith that these two sons ofam at
[17:08]one point Allah he asks them for sacrifice he wants to see
[17:13]which of these two sons is more sincere and so he says
[17:15]that I want you to bring the best of what you have
[17:19]and place it in front of me as a sacrifice Hab he
[17:25]was an individual that was into animal husbandry meaning that he had
[17:31]flock of sheep it is mentioned in the that he was a
[17:35]farmer he would engage in agricultural work and so he brings some
[17:41]very low quality grains that he had that is his sacrifice and
[17:44]he brings the best sheep the best Ram that he had amongst
[17:49]his flock and that is his sacrifice now what ends up taking
[17:54]place is that when we look at the story and we look
[17:56]at the fossil record we find that agriculture did not exist 200,000
[18:04]years ago when does agriculture first appear it first appears about 10,000
[18:10]or 11,000 years ago so we're running into problem number one that
[18:14]if we say that 200,000 years ago it was the firstam The
[18:18]first Homo Sapien then we now have an issue with this that
[18:23]if he's into agriculture then that was only 10,000 years ago problem
[18:26]number two is that when you continue with the story of and
[18:32]eventually he kills he murders his brother habil now what's interesting is
[18:41]that the Quran mentions this that when he murders his brother he
[18:45]doesn't know what to do with the body and the Quran actually
[18:52]mentions that Allah he sends a crow the crow scratches into the
[18:55]Earth and he shows that when a body has been deceased you
[18:58]are supposed to bury it underneath the Earth there's this burial process
[19:03]now what's strange about this is that when you look at the
[19:07]fossil record you look at the historical record you find that burial
[19:10]was something that the homo sapiens they had from the very beginning
[19:14]even before Homo sapiens came about those other beings had existed even
[19:19]they had customs of burial where they would take one another they
[19:24]would bury the bodies they would even have little bits of food
[19:26]that they would place in the grave they would put jewelry in
[19:28]the grave sometimes they would Place horses in the grave how is
[19:33]it that he doesn't know about the burial custom if he's from
[19:41]this long line of other beings then he should have seen burials
[19:44]he should have seen others who passed away and they are then
[19:48]placed underneath the Earth then we run into the third issue and
[19:52]this is an amazing issue when you look at the verses of
[19:58]the Holy Quran about the creation of and the response of the
[20:03]Mal to Allah saying that I'm going to place him as my
[20:05]vice gerant on the face of this Earth the Angels say something
[20:11]that they should not have had knowledge of what do the Mala
[20:19]say Allah he says oh I'm going to be placing Adam as
[20:24]myif on the face of this Earth the Mal there [Music] respond
[20:35]the Mal they say Ya Allah are you really going to be
[20:42]giving this high rank to this creation that sheds blood and causes
[20:46]corruption on the face of this earth now there's a Hadith by
[20:51]IM where the Imam he says the following he says what would
[20:57]have made the Angels know to say will you place there in
[21:00]someone who will cause corruption and shed blood had they not witnessed
[21:08]those who cause corruption and shed blood the Imam is pointing to
[21:11]a reality he says that these Mal that they're asking Allah about
[21:15]this that this being Adam he's a very violent being he's a
[21:19]corrupt being we've seen this before the Imam is pointing to a
[21:26]reality that perhaps there were other beings that resembled now this leads
[21:32]us to a discussion of beings known as the nasnas when we
[21:37]look at Islamic Hadith the imams 1,400 years ago I want you
[21:44]to keep this in mind, 1400 years ago there's no discussion of
[21:50]evolution there's no discussion of fossil record this is not even in
[21:54]the minds of the people they begin to discuss beings that were
[21:58]known as nesnas n literally means humanlike beings and they explained that
[22:08]before the creation ofam there were other beings that were resembling the
[22:14]human being and Allah subhana waala would create one group of them
[22:18]he would give them an opportunity and they would begin to cause
[22:21]corruption and shed blood so they would be destroyed when they were
[22:25]destroyed Allah subhana Wa ta'ala Would create another group they would again
[22:31]cause corruption and they would be destroyed and this continued over and
[22:35]over and over again until the creation of adam.
[22:39]now here the Islamic scholars they've brought all of these things together
[22:44]they've looked at the fossil record they've looked at the verses of
[22:47]the Quran they've looked at the they've looked at the different theories
[22:53]they've said that we can have a conclusive and comprehensive theory of
[22:57]evolution that works for us as Muslims what is that theory they
[23:01]have said that it is possible that Allah subhah wa ta'ala he
[23:05]created these other beings through the process of evolution these other beings
[23:13]that came before even when we look at Homo sapiens it is
[23:16]possible that even they were created through the process of evolution but
[23:21]they said that when we look at the verses of the Holy
[23:24]Quran when we look at the when we look at these pieces
[23:29]of evidence they say that it makes sense that Adam was a
[23:33]unique and a distinct creation of God that Allah subhana wa tala
[23:37]he said be and Adam was created that maybe he resembled in
[23:45]shape those other beings but there was something special about this being
[23:49]of God and that was the rof that Allah subhanahu wa'ta'ala had
[23:53]placed within him this potential which allowed Adam to have that role
[23:59]as Theif of Allah on the face of this Earth so this
[24:03]is one way that we could deal with this theory of evolution
[24:06]we could bring all of these different things together we could accept
[24:09]potentially the idea that things were created through Evolution while continuing to
[24:15]hold to this idea of the verses of the Quran and theth
[24:19]now here I just wanted to conclude by mentioning just a few
[24:23]points Point number one we do have to understand that the theory
[24:29]of evolution is just a the you know I give this example
[24:33]that when you are looking at the fossil record what we are
[24:36]seeing is a little bit of evidence that is here and a
[24:38]little bit of evidence that is here and a little bit of
[24:41]evidence that is here and it's like the example of a jigsaw
[24:44]puzzle I don't know if you've ever bought these jigsaw puzzles and
[24:49]then your kids get a hold of the jigsaw puzzle and then
[24:51]you have to say fat too many of the pieces and sometimes
[24:55]you don't know until one day you're putting it all together and
[24:58]you realize that there's a whole bunch of pieces missing from the
[25:00]jigsaw puzzle but this is literally what they are doing it's a
[25:06]500 piece jigsaw puzzle and scientists only have 30 40 50 of
[25:10]those pieces and they're doing the best that they can to put
[25:13]those pieces together to have an image of how we were created
[25:17]as human beings but we have to acknowledge that it is a
[25:22]very incomplete picture the second issue is that there is no problem
[25:26]with not believing in evolution again as we mentioned it's simply a
[25:30]theory a theory that one day they can say that we were
[25:35]incorrect just like many other theories after 50 100 500 thousand years
[25:39]they say that you know what the theory that we had we
[25:42]got it wrong we were incorrect at the same time we also
[25:47]have to say that there is nothing wrong with believing in the
[25:50]theory of evolution even in the fact that Adam maybe he was
[25:52]created through the process of evolution with that said I think that
[25:58]the best way of looking at it is what the have mentioned
[26:01]and others they've gone over this Theory and it's a very comprehensive
[26:05]and it's a very conclusive idea of evolution I wanted to end
